Ashburton Park is a park located in Woodside, London. The park is located next to Woodside tram stop in the London Borough of Croydon. Tramlink Routes 1 and 2 service the park. It is on the junction of Lower Addiscombe Road and Spring Lane. The park covers an area of 18½ acres (7.49 hectares). The park includes a village green and a café.
[edit] Facilities
The facilities in the park include:
- Car park (entrance in Tenterden Road)
- Children's playground
- Toilets
- Shelter
- Bowling green & pavilion
- Netball & basketball court
- Tennis courts
- Petanque terrain see www.croydoncommunity.co.uk free to play, small fee to become full member
There are also recycling facilities for paper and bottles in the park. The ground is enclosed and locked at nights.
